> I've started seeing this line after failed emerges: |
3 |
> |
4 |
> |
5 |
> |
6 |
> checking for C compiler default output file name... configure: error: C |
7 |
> compiler cannot create executables |
8 |
> |
9 |
> Checking gcc-config returns this: |
10 |
> carter sys-devel # gcc-config -l |
11 |
> * gcc-config: Active gcc profile is invalid! |
12 |
> [1] i686-pc-linux-gnu-4.3.4 |
13 |
> |
14 |
> |
15 |
> How can I get gcc back? |
16 |
|
17 |
try to run "gcc-config 1" as root to have it re-configure your gcc |
18 |
settings/links. |
